I thought you had dirs there, I always use du -sbc on directories to hunt down :)

Installation is not the same as functioning, you should be able to see the old
versions gzipped if it is working and configured right. Again though 
burning through that much disk space that fast and having a file that big
for "normal" usage is odd although I don't know your history.
